Abstract:
The invention relates to a method for controlling a wind power plant comprising a plurality of wind turbines being operatively connected to a plant collector grid, the method comprising the steps of providing a desired power reference signal; determining the power production of the wind power plant, and generating an actual power reference signal in response thereto; comparing the desired power reference signal with the actual power reference signal, and performing one of the following steps: 1) applying a first filter characteristic as part of a generation of a wind turbine power reference if the desired power reference signal exceeds the actual power reference signal; or 2) applying a second filter characteristic as part of the generation of the wind turbine power reference if the actual power reference signal exceeds the desired power reference signal, wherein the first filter characteristic is different from the second filter characteristic. The invention also relates to a power plant controller, a wind power plant and a computer program product.
Abstract:
The invention relates to a method of controlling a wind turbine (WT) in a wind power plant, the wind turbine comprises a wind turbine controller (WTC) and at least one connected wind turbine component (WTCO) the wind turbine controller (WTC) receiving data packets (DP) originating from a central controller (CC), at least one of said data packets comprising instructions, the WTC performing the followings steps if one of said data packets (DP) comprises a combined "write/read" instruction (WRI) - effectuating a write instruction designated by said data packets (DP), - retrieving information data (ID) resulting from the above effectuation of said write instruction from at least one of said wind turbine component (WTCO), - transmitting said information data to said central controller (CC) upon reception of the information data from at least one wind turbine components (WTCO).
Abstract:
The invention relates to a method of registering events in a wind power system comprising at least two data processors, wherein the data processors of said wind power system are mutually time synchronized, wherein events are registered in said at least two data processors, wherein the timing of said events registered in different of said at least two data processors is established according to said time synchronization. According to an advantageous embodiment of the invention, events may be registered and preferably analyzed according to a common timing. This analyzing makes it possible to establish an analysis where events of different wind turbines are basically interrelated and where information regarding such interrelation is important or crucial for establishment of control or fault detection based on correctly timed events from different wind turbines.
Abstract:
A method for authorisation of a user to access a computer system locally at a site is described. The computer system determines whether a network connection to a remote authentication source is available. If the network connection is available, the computer system authenticates the user by interaction with the remote authentication source. If the network connection is not available, the computer system authenticates the user against a credential provided by the user. In this case, the credential will have been provided by or validated by the remote authentication source less than a predetermined time prior to the authenticating step, and the credential is a certificate issued by a certificate authority already trusted by the computer system and valid for a predetermined period of time. A suitable computer system is also described.

Abstract:
The invention relates to a central controller (CC) adapted for controlling a number of wind turbines (WT), said wind turbines (WT) are controlled and monitored by said central controller (CC) via a first monitoring and control network (MCNl) and a second monitoring and control network (MCN2). The term monitoring and control network is in accordance with an embodiment of the invention understood as a data communication network which communicates at least control data for control of wind turbines, but may also communicate monitoring data, i.e. measure data. A typical example of a control of wind turbines is that the central controller sets the power set-point (the power to be produced) of each wind turbine in the wind power plant. A further advantageous feature of the invention is also that the important control signals may be separated from high-bandwidth requiring monitoring data, such as analysis data in the communication network.
